As CAN President, Pastor Ayo, Testifies
Before U.S. Congress CPC Mouthpiece Calls
Him "Self Serving Hypocrite"

Apparently not everyone is happy with Christian
Association of Nigeria (CAN) President, Pastor
Ayo Oritsejafor's, testimony before the U.S.
congress.
Yesterday Pastor Ayo Oritsejafor had pleaded
with the U.S. Congress to label Boko Haram and their sponsors as terrorists. He plaintively
appealed to the U.S. to bring pressure to bear
on the Islamic sect because "my people are
dying everyday".
Pastor Ayo, told the House Foreign Affairs
Committee that“It is hypocritical for the United
States and the international community to say
that they believe in freedom and equality when
their actions do not support those who are being persecuted,”.
A designation as a foreign terrorist organization
would trigger a full US government response
against Boko Haram, freezing any assets it holds in the United States and making support of the group a crime.
But Pastor Ayo's comments did not go down
with fiery activist, Kayode Ogundamisi, who was a Buhari supporter and unofficial spokesman of the Congress for Progressive Change (CPC) candidate.
Mr. Ogundamisi in a series of tweets accused
the President of CAN, Pastor Ayo of being a
hypocrite. He also alluded that Pastor Ayo was
intolerant of Muslims. Mr. Ogundamisi's tweets
appear below.
